Apartment for sale in Sofia

This is an offer for a perfect, fully furnished apartment for sale, located in the city of Sofia. The property is situated in a new residential building with permission for usage since July 2007 year. It was rent out for about 4 years for an exhibition space for samples to an Italian fashion company.

The apartment is facing south / east and is situated on the first residential floor (above garages). It has 25 cm brick walls with insulation 6 cm, PVC 5-chamber window joineries. It comprises with total living area of 98 sq m. There is an entrance lounge - 8 sq m, 2 sq m closet, bathroom - 4 sq m, living room with kitchen - 35 sq m, bedroom - 17 sq m and a 10 sq m terrace.

The property is equipped with Austrian kitchen fittings, two-chamber refrigerator - Liebherr Inox, microwave - Sharp, multi-split air conditioning system - Fujitsu, backup electric boiler - Ariston 30 liters. There is video and security system. The price includes 4 sq m basement. The apartment also comes with 19 sq m of land areas.
